As the Aggies advanced the ball up the court with 34 seconds to play in just their second game of the season, they were in near free-fall. Just three short minutes ago they led VCU by 13, a further eight minutes before that Utah State had been up 18. The good 'ol fashioned ESPN odds of winning calculator was spitting out chances north of 99 percent for an Aggie victory.
But as the clock ticked under a half-minute, the score sat tied 76-all. VCU had surged back, outscoring the Aggies 14-1 in the previous few minutes to turn a disaster of an outing for the Rams into a chance for what at one point seemed like impossible victory.
